No, there is a way. My friend from work has a galant which is the same platform as the eclipse. Same engine, same electronics, same wiring, same ecu. There is a pin on the inside of the front ecu ( the red thing in the fuse box) that if you remove disables the running lights. DRLs are not required by law in any state or they would come standard on all new vehicles. thanks for responding.

You do not need to cut the pin, just bent it all the way so it touches (or almost touches) the side of the box...I was afraid to do this as well but I was suprised how easy it was, plus you can always bend it back into place...my DRL is disabled .
